Find the coordinates of \(M\) in the original system if the point \(M\) changes to \((4,-3)\) when the axes are rotated through an angle of \(135^{\circ}\).

  1. A \(\left(\frac{-1}{2}, \frac{7}{2}\right)\)
  2. B \(\left(\frac{1}{2}, \frac{7}{2}\right)\)
  3. C \(\left(\frac{-1}{\sqrt{2}}, \frac{1}{\sqrt{2}}\right)\)
  4. D \(\left(\frac{1}{\sqrt{2}}, \frac{7}{\sqrt{2}}\right)\)
